Directions: Choose the option that best expresses the meaning of the idiom which is underlined.

While driving he should keep a weather eye open.

  1. keep window glasses down

  2. aware of weather condition

  3. be watchful to avoid trouble

  4. patience

Reveal answer Fill a bubble to check yourself
C Correct answer
Explanation

'To keep a weather eye open' means to remain watchful, alert, and attentive to potential dangers or changes. Option C correctly identifies this meaning of being watchful to avoid trouble. The phrase originates from sailing, where sailors had to watch weather conditions carefully.
